Bob Davie has already matched New Mexico's win total from past 3 years
Six games into his tenure as the New Mexico head coach, Bob Davie has already matched their win total from the past 3 seasons.
In the three years under former head coach Mike Locksley, stretching from 2009-2011, the Lobo's won 3 games.
Davie has already collected three wins in six games. The Lobos wins have come against Southern University (FCS), Texas State, and in state rival New Mexico State, a team that the Lobos hadn't beat since 2008. The Lobo's also had a chance to win it against Boise State last week before eventually falling 32-29.
This past weekend against Texas State, the The Lobos (3-3, 1-1) carried the ball 59 times for 361 yards (200 in the first half), and only aired it out three times (1 for 3 for 9 yards) in their 35-14 win. Texas State beat Houston 30-13 to open up the season.
